摘要
The creep-damage behaviour of rock salt, especially in the tertiary creep phase has been rarely investigated. The creep-damage-rupture characteristics of rock salt are studied in this paper by applying Wang's creep-damage model, the experimental results of the biaxial destructive creep-damage tests using quasi-static loading on rock salt specimens are presented, complete creep-damage curves are obtained, and the evolution laws of deformation and damage of rock salt in the primary (transitional), secondary (steady-state) and tertiary (accelerating) phases are deduced. The long-term behaviour of dilatancy of rock salt is investigated according to the dilatancy boundary theory and an approximate long-term dilatancy boundary range is obtained. Finally, the long-term strength of rock salt is evaluated for the test samples. The used model proves to conform well to the test data, including in the tertiary creep-damage phase; it can be suitable for the assessment of collapse, cracking, rupture and other long-term failures, and hence for theoretical basis of design in the underground engineering of gas and oil storage cavern, nuclear waste disposal and other facilities in salt deposit.
